Things To Do
in Codru
Codru is a picturesque region of Moldova known for its serene landscapes, lush vineyards, and rich cultural heritage. Nestled near the capital, Chișinău, it offers a tranquil escape from the hustle and bustle of city life. The area is renowned for its traditional winemaking, inviting visitors to explore local wineries and savor the unique flavors of Moldovan cuisine.
With friendly locals and a welcoming atmosphere, Codru is an ideal destination for those seeking an authentic experience in Moldova.

How to Behave
Tips on cultural norms and respectful behavior
A firm handshake and direct eye contact are the norm when greeting someone.
It is customary to accept offers of food or drink when visiting someone's home.
Casual but neat attire is generally acceptable, though dressing up is appreciated for special occasions.

Tipping in Codru
Ensure a smooth experience
Tipping is customary in Moldova; a tip of 10-15% is appreciated in restaurants.
Most establishments accept cash (Moldovan Leu) and major credit cards, but it's wise to carry some cash.
